Bryozoan - Fenestella lonsdale

Description

Bryozoans are colonial animals that live in both freshwater and seawater. A colony is composed of hundreds of very tiny individuals, each of which has a special organ that filters small food particles from the water. Bryozoan colonies are attached to the seafloor or to other organisms. Fan and bush-shaped colonies like this bryozoan may have functioned as bafflers.
